Program Description:

The greatest demand in the world today is not for managers, but for leaders. Southwestern College’s master of science in leadership (MSL) program prepares people in any industry for leadership positions. Learn relationship management and leadership skills to become more effective in any organization, whether military, corporate, government, health care, small business, education or non-profit.
The emphasis is on practical application of key leadership principles in contemporary organizations.

The MSL program is available completely online.

Eligibility Requirements:

To be admitted into the Master of Science in Leadership program, candidates must submit the following:

• Southwestern College Professional Studies Graduate Program Application form – Application forms are accepted on an ongoing basis. No application admission fee is charged.

• Official transcripts of all prior college/university coursework – Applicants must hold a baccalaureate degree from a regionally accredited institution with a grade point average of 2.5 or higher (on a 4.0 scale).

• Two confidential letters of recommendation – at least one from a current or former employer

• A one page Admissions Essay – submit your written statement electronically to graduate@sckans.edu or via mail or fax to 316.688.5218.

• Resume - Applicants should have at least three years of professional work experience.
